Assessing Your Needs and Goals
Identifying Your Purpose
Before diving into the design process, you must identify the primary purpose of the space you’re planning to fit out. Is it a cozy living room, a functional office, or a vibrant restaurant? Understanding the purpose will guide your design choices.
Establishing a Budget
Determine your budget early in the process. It will help you make informed decisions about materials, furniture, and professional services. Ensure that your budget is realistic and includes a contingency for unexpected expenses.
Defining Your Style
Your interior fit-out should reflect your personal style. Whether it’s minimalistic, classic, or eclectic, defining your style will streamline the design process and help you choose elements that resonate with your taste.
Space Planning and Layout
Measuring Your Space
Accurate measurements are the foundation of a successful fit-out. Measure the space meticulously, noting the location of doors, windows, and any structural elements that may impact the layout.
Creating Functional Zones
Divide the space into functional zones based on your needs. This step ensures that your fit-out not only looks good but also serves its intended purpose efficiently.
Optimal Furniture Placement
Plan the placement of furniture items carefully. Consider traffic flow, natural light, and focal points when arranging your furniture.

Permits and Regulations
Researching Local Codes
Familiarize yourself with local building codes and regulations. Ensure that your fit-out complies with all legal requirements.
Obtaining Necessary Permits
If required, obtain the necessary permits before commencing construction. Failure to do so can lead to costly delays and legal issues.
